Front sticker.. The rego stitcher will be gone in june was i redo rego, and the fire stitcher will be gone as soon as i can fine something to get it off with lol.


You can remove it now if you want, not required to wait for rego to run out.
As for getting them off, get a hair dryer or heat gun onto it and a sharp blade (or the BBQ scrapper is my favourite as its easier to handle). Heat the glue on the sticker, scrap it off then get some goo off or eucalyptus oil and wipe away the residue left. wash with paper towel and water and your done.
